Mozambique's Orthopedic & Trauma Care Evolution

Mozambique's medical sector is undergoing significant modernization, steered by the Ministry of Health (MISAU). A primary driver is the rising need for high-quality orthopedic implants, particularly in trauma departments at major institutions like the Hospital Central de Maputo (HCM), Hospital Central da Beira, and Hospital Central de Nampula.

Rapid infrastructure development, expanding mining activities in provinces like Tete, and urbanization have led to an increase in high-energy trauma cases, such as road traffic accidents and industrial incidents. Historically dependent on basic external fixators, Mozambican surgeons are increasingly shifting toward modern internal fixation techniques. The clinical deployment of titanium and stainless steel cannulated screws has become essential for managing femoral neck fractures, tibial plateau fractures, and complex articular reconstructions.

To optimize patient recovery times and reduce hospital bed-occupancy rates, healthcare systems require imports of reliable, bio-compatible implants that prevent implant failure, surgical revisions, and postoperative infections. Surgical Implant Metallurgy & Mechanical Engineering

We specialize in manufacturing orthopedic implants designed to endure high biomechanical stress. Below are the engineering standards that make our cannulated screws reliable for clinical use.

Biocompatibility & Materials

Manufactured from Grade 5 Titanium (Ti-6Al-4V ELI) conforming to ASTM F136, and Medical Grade Stainless Steel (316LVM) conforming to ASTM F138. These materials are chosen for their excellent fatigue strength and low elastic modulus, reducing the risk of stress shielding in bone healing.

Thread Profiles & Cannulation

Features a precise hollow core (cannulation) designed for guide-wire guided placement. Self-drilling and self-tapping thread geometries minimize mechanical stress during insertion, reducing the risk of micro-fractures in osteoporotic bone structures.

Compression Dynamics

Engineered with varying thread pitches and headless options to deliver controlled, uniform compression across fracture gaps. This design supports anatomical reduction and stable fixation, which is crucial for early patient mobilization.

Import Logistics & Registration Support for Mozambique

Navigating the import protocols for medical hardware in Mozambique requires regulatory diligence and logistics planning. All medical device imports must comply with registration guidelines established by the Ministry of Health (MISAU). As a strategic supply partner, we provide comprehensive documentation support to facilitate these processes.

Our logistics support includes full certification packets—such as Certificate of Free Sale (CFS), ISO 13485 registration, CE declarations of conformity, and detailed material mill certificates. This documentation helps minimize delays at import hubs like Maputo Port, Beira Port, and Maputo International Airport.

We offer robust transport packaging options. Implants can be shipped in sterile, individual double-barrier blister packs or as non-sterile bulk configurations designed to fit existing sterilization tray configurations in local hospitals.

Technology Roadmap: Future of Orthopedic Trauma Hardware

We focus on continuous product development to incorporate material innovations that support clinical outcomes in emerging markets.

Surface Modifications

Research indicates that micro-structured, anodized surfaces help improve osteointegration. We are developing proprietary surface-roughening techniques that facilitate faster bone anchorage, reducing the recovery window for trauma patients.

Bioabsorbable Alternatives

In collaboration with research labs, we are evaluating biodegradable magnesium alloys for internal fixations. These materials are designed to dissolve gradually once bone healing is complete, potentially eliminating the need for a second surgery to remove the implant.

What is the typical transit time to the Port of Maputo or Beira?
Sea freight transit times to Maputo Port or Beira Port generally range between 25 and 35 days, depending on shipping line schedules. For urgent clinical requirements, air freight to Maputo International Airport (MPM) can deliver emergency orders within 7 to 10 working days.

How are the implants packaged to ensure sterile delivery to Mozambican surgical theaters?
Implants are typically supplied in non-sterile bulk packaging designed to fit standard hospital sterilization trays. Alternatively, we can provide sterile, double-barrier Tyvek blister packaging sterilized via Ethylene Oxide (EO) or Gamma radiation, which allows for immediate surgical use.
